Title :
Optimization research on the energy-conserving generation dispatch based on rough sets
Author_Institution :
Dept. of Mech. Eng., North China Electr. Power Univ., Baoding, China
Abstract :
In order to insure the credibility of electric power supply, and improve the speed of the energy conservation and consumption reduction, this paper proposes the index system according by the generation units operating status in quo. Considering the number of indexes and the requirement of precision, the paper applies rough set theory to reduce the index attributes and establishes the model based on rough set to do optimization research on the energy conserving generation dispatch, and applies it to the optimization process of the energy conserving generation dispatch of southern Hebei grid. The result proves the model is feasible and effective, shows this method can improve the evaluation precision and has good spread ability.
